Maryland Stop on Red Day at Camden Yards

September 3, 2003, 7:05 p.m

The National Campaign to Stop Red Light Running is teaming up with the Baltimore Orioles for Stop on Red Night at Camden Yards to highlight National Stop on Red Week and to urge Marylanders to Stop on Red.

  • Free Posters! — As you enter the ballpark, you will receive a National Stop on Red Week poster featuring Baltimore Orioles player spokesman Melvin Mora

  • Pre-Game Ceremony —The Baltimore Orioles will join the National Campaign to Stop Red Light Running, the Maryland Division of the American Trauma Society, and the Maryland Institute of Emergency Medical Services System in honoring Maryland Delegate William A. Bronrott (D-16, Bethesda) for his red light running prevention efforts

  • Red Light Running safety messages on the scoreboard and the Red Means Stop Coalition PSA on the Diamondvision

  • Red light running safety messages on the scoreboard

  • Billboards — “Get Home Safe” billboards will be placed at five different locations in the Baltimore area for a month-long period around National Stop on Red Week, courtesy of the Outdoor Advertising Association of America.
